Over NIS 70 million allocated to Education Ministry amid concerns over National Service cuts

The government allocated over NIS 70 million to the Ministry of Education to address concerns over potential cuts to National Service positions, according to a report by ynet.

The allocation follows reports of a possible reduction in National Service slots, a program that provides an alternative to military service for eligible Israelis. The funds are intended to preserve existing positions and prevent a disruption to the program. The specific mechanism and timeline for the transfer have not yet been detailed.
